  • Sheets, pillows, duvet covers, and faux fur blankets are in direct contact with your skin every night, so they're a lot like the clothes you wear during the day—and should be washed almost as frequently. Blankets and comforters may have very little contact with your skin and can be washed less often.

    Before washing sheets and bed linens, always read each item's label to maintain your bedding over time. To wash bedding, choose the hottest setting recommended, pre-treat stains with stain removers or oxygen cleaners, select an appropriate detergent for each type of fabric, and then tumble dry on low heat to prevent shrinking and damage.
